Charles Schwab Investment Management Inc. lifted its position in shares of TeraWulf Inc. (NASDAQ:WULF – Free Report) by 4.5%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The firm owned 2,469,948 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 105,997 shares during the period. Charles Schwab Investment Management Inc.’s holdings in TeraWulf were worth $13,980,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.
Other institutional investors and hedge funds have also modified their holdings of the company. State Street Corp lifted its stake in shares of TeraWulf by 3.8% during the third quarter. State Street Corp now owns 6,283,196 shares of the company’s stock valued at $29,405,000 after buying an additional 227,186 shares during the period. GoalVest Advisory LLC purchased a new position in shares of TeraWulf during the fourth quarter valued at approximately $651,000. Intech Investment Management LLC purchased a new position in shares of TeraWulf during the third quarter valued at approximately $340,000. Barclays PLC lifted its stake in shares of TeraWulf by 419.7% during the third quarter. Barclays PLC now owns 424,748 shares of the company’s stock valued at $1,989,000 after buying an additional 343,016 shares during the period. Finally, Exchange Traded Concepts LLC raised its stake in TeraWulf by 6.7% during the fourth quarter. Exchange Traded Concepts LLC now owns 1,316,786 shares of the company’s stock worth $7,453,000 after purchasing an additional 83,008 shares during the period. Hedge funds and other institutional investors own 62.49% of the company’s stock.
Analyst Ratings Changes
WULF has been the topic of a number of research analyst reports. Northland Securities reiterated an “outperform” rating and issued a $10.00 price target on shares of TeraWulf in a report on Tuesday, December 24th. Cantor Fitzgerald reiterated an “overweight” rating and issued a $11.00 price target on shares of TeraWulf in a report on Monday, January 6th. Keefe, Bruyette & Woods initiated coverage on shares of TeraWulf in a report on Wednesday, January 8th. They issued a “market perform” rating on the stock. B. Riley lifted their price target on shares of TeraWulf from $8.00 to $10.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a report on Thursday, December 19th. Finally, Rosenblatt Securities reiterated a “buy” rating and issued a $10.00 price target on shares of TeraWulf in a report on Monday, March 3rd.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a hold rating, six have given a buy rating and two have given a strong buy r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, TeraWulf currently has an average rating of “Buy” and an average price target of $9.50.
TeraWulf Trading Down 0.3 %
Shares of WULF stock opened at $3.20 on Friday. The company’s fifty day simple moving average is $4.51 and its 200-day simple moving average is $5.46. TeraWulf Inc. has a 52 week low of $1.82 and a 52 week high of $9.30. The company has a market cap of $1.23 billion, a PE ratio of -16.00 and a beta of 2.70.
TeraWulf (NASDAQ:WULF –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Friday, February 28th. The company reported ($0.08) E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.04) by ($0.04). TeraWulf had a negative net margin of 41.88% and a negative return on equity of 15.91%. The business had revenue of $35.00 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$37.43 million. TeraWulf’s revenue was up 50.2% on a year-over-year basis. Equities research analysts expect that TeraWulf Inc. will post -0.17 EPS for the current fiscal year.
About TeraWulf
TeraWulf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a digital asset technology company in the United States. The company develops, owns, and operates bitcoin mining facilities in New York and Pennsylvania. It is also involved in the provision of miner hosting services to third-party entities. The company was founded in 2021 and is headquartered in Easton, Maryland.
